摘要
A novel soluble 7r-conjugated polymer, poly [(3-acetylpyrrole-2, 5-diyl) p-(N, N-dimethylamino) azobenzylidene] (PA-PDMAABE), was synthesized by condensation of 3-acetylpyrrole with 4-aldehyde-4’-dimethylaminoazobenzene (AD-MAA). The chemical structure of PAPDMAABE was characterized by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R),1H-NMR, and UV-Vis-NIR spectra. Transmission electron microscope (TEM) analysis for PAPDMAABE indicatesthat part of PAPDMAABE is in crystal state, due to the short-range order of the polymer. Thermogravimetric analy-sis (TGA) curve shows that the polymer has good thermal stability and its decomposition temperature is 248°C. Theoptical band gap of PAPDMAABE obtained from the optical absorption spectrum is about 1.73 eV. The resonantthird-order nonlinear optical property of PAPDMAABE at 532 nm was studied using degenerate four-wave mixing(DFWM) technique. The resonant third-order nonlinear optical susceptibility of the polymer is about 7.48×10-8 esu.
